Dear Parents/Guardians; The Elementary Teachers Federation of Ontario (ETFO) has indicated that they will hold a one day strike at all schools in the UCDSB next week. This means that teachers will not be in school and many schools will have picket lines outside.

We strongly encourage parents to make alternate child care arrangements now. We recognize that this will be a significant inconvenience for parents and guardians.

We intend to keep our schools open for those who have no other options for child care. Please note that schools will not be operating a regular instructional program. Students will be supervised in common areas such as the gymnasium and/or library.

To ensure that we have the necessary resources in place to safely supervise students, we require parents to declare their intention for the day.
